一種矩形波信號(hào)過(guò)零濾波方法及裝置的制造方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明屬于電子技術(shù)領(lǐng)域,設(shè)及一種矩形波信號(hào)過(guò)零濾波方法及裝置。
【背景技術(shù)】
[0002] 在一些控制電路,如PWM調(diào)制、可控娃點(diǎn)觸發(fā)等,需要根據(jù)信號(hào)的過(guò)零點(diǎn)來(lái)確定控 制基準(zhǔn)時(shí)刻。該類信號(hào)往往都處理成了矩形波信號(hào),W方便后續(xù)的數(shù)字電路的處理與變換。
[0003] 但是,在基準(zhǔn)信號(hào)處理成矩形波信號(hào)的時(shí)候,若原始信號(hào)中有干擾,處理后的方波 信號(hào)也有干擾,尤其過(guò)零點(diǎn)的干擾更嚴(yán)重。一個(gè)典型的受干擾的矩形波信號(hào)如圖1所示。
[0004] 為了排除干擾信號(hào),往往需要濾波電路。對(duì)該種高頻干擾,常用的就是低通濾波 器,一個(gè)典型的低通濾波器電路如圖2所示。
[0005] 低通濾波器在濾除干擾的同時(shí),會(huì)產(chǎn)生延遲。在一個(gè)參數(shù)確定的濾波電路中,不同 的輸入信號(hào)產(chǎn)生的延遲還不相同。在技術(shù)上用相頻特性曲線來(lái)表示該種延遲的變化情況, 如圖3所示。
[0006] 采用傳統(tǒng)的低通濾波電路,除了延遲外,還不能識(shí)別干擾的寬度。在干擾時(shí)間段, 信號(hào)是高頻的,濾波后的信號(hào)輸出是0,只有在干擾停止后,信號(hào)輸出才正確反映輸入信號(hào)。
【發(fā)明內(nèi)容】
[0007] 有鑒于此,本發(fā)明的目的在于提供一種矩形波信號(hào)過(guò)零濾波方法及裝置,對(duì)于過(guò) 零點(diǎn)信號(hào)而言,在零點(diǎn)附近的干擾是對(duì)稱的,因此正確的零點(diǎn)應(yīng)位于過(guò)零點(diǎn)干擾的中間時(shí) 亥IJ,應(yīng)根據(jù)干擾的時(shí)刻和寬度來(lái)確定過(guò)零信號(hào)的正確發(fā)生時(shí)間。該方法根據(jù)干擾的時(shí)刻和 寬度來(lái)確定過(guò)零信號(hào)的正確發(fā)生時(shí)間,然后對(duì)信號(hào)的濾波延遲進(jìn)行補(bǔ)償,輸出修正后的信 號(hào)。
[000引本發(fā)明的目的之一是提供一種矩形波信號(hào)過(guò)零濾波方法,本發(fā)明的目的之二是提 供一種矩形波信號(hào)過(guò)零濾波裝置。
[0009] 本發(fā)明的目的之一是通過(guò)W下技術(shù)方案來(lái)實(shí)現(xiàn)的:
[0010] 一種矩形波信號(hào)過(guò)零濾波方法,該方法包括W下步驟:
[0011] 步驟1)輸入信號(hào)經(jīng)濾波模塊進(jìn)行濾波處理;
[0012] 步驟2)過(guò)零寬度統(tǒng)計(jì)模塊統(tǒng)計(jì)信號(hào)的過(guò)零寬度
[0013] 步驟3)周期統(tǒng)計(jì)模塊統(tǒng)計(jì)濾波后信號(hào)的周期T;
[0014] 步驟4)根據(jù)信號(hào)的周期、過(guò)零點(diǎn)干擾寬度、過(guò)零點(diǎn)時(shí)刻,經(jīng)時(shí)間校正模塊對(duì)信號(hào) 的濾波延遲進(jìn)行補(bǔ)償,輸出修正后的信號(hào)。
[0015]進(jìn)一步,所述步驟1)對(duì)輸入信號(hào)進(jìn)行濾波處理具體為;W持續(xù)有效寬度Tf作為濾 波條件對(duì)輸入信號(hào)進(jìn)行濾波,輸出具有Tf延遲的濾波后信號(hào)。
[0016] 進(jìn)一步,所述過(guò)零寬度L為從過(guò)零干擾開(kāi)始到濾波結(jié)束的時(shí)間。
[0017] 進(jìn)一步,所述過(guò)零點(diǎn)時(shí)刻為過(guò)零點(diǎn)干擾的中間時(shí)刻。
[0018] 進(jìn)一步,通過(guò)W下公式對(duì)濾波后信號(hào)進(jìn)行修正,
[0019]
【主權(quán)項(xiàng)】
1. 一種矩形波信號(hào)過(guò)零濾波方法,其特征在于:該方法包括以下步驟: 步驟1)輸入信號(hào)經(jīng)濾波模塊進(jìn)行濾波處理; 步驟2)過(guò)零寬度統(tǒng)計(jì)模塊統(tǒng)計(jì)信號(hào)的過(guò)零寬度Tz; 步驟3)周期統(tǒng)計(jì)模塊統(tǒng)計(jì)濾波后信號(hào)的周期T; 步驟4)根據(jù)信號(hào)的周期、過(guò)零點(diǎn)干擾寬度、過(guò)零點(diǎn)時(shí)刻,經(jīng)時(shí)間校正模塊對(duì)信號(hào)的濾 波延遲進(jìn)行補(bǔ)償,輸出修正后的信號(hào)。
2. 根據(jù)權(quán)利要求1所述的一種矩形波信號(hào)過(guò)零濾波方法,其特征在于:所述步驟1)對(duì) 輸入信號(hào)進(jìn)行濾波處理具體為:以持續(xù)有效寬度Tf作為濾波條件對(duì)輸入信號(hào)進(jìn)行濾波,輸 出具有Tf延遲的濾波后信號(hào)。
3. 根據(jù)權(quán)利要求1所述的一種矩形波信號(hào)過(guò)零濾波方法,其特征在于:所述過(guò)零寬度 Tz為從過(guò)零干擾開(kāi)始到濾波結(jié)束的時(shí)間。
4. 根據(jù)權(quán)利要求1所述的一種矩形波信號(hào)過(guò)零濾波方法,其特征在于:所述過(guò)零點(diǎn)時(shí) 刻為過(guò)零點(diǎn)干擾的中間時(shí)刻。
5. 根據(jù)權(quán)利要求1所述的一種矩形波信號(hào)過(guò)零濾波方法,其特征在于:通過(guò)以下公式 對(duì)濾波后信號(hào)進(jìn)行修正,
其中,T。為修正后的信號(hào)過(guò)零時(shí)刻比濾波結(jié)束時(shí)刻提前的時(shí)間,Tf為濾波時(shí)間,Tz為過(guò) 零寬度。
6. -種矩形波信號(hào)過(guò)零濾波裝置,其特征在于:該電路包括濾波模塊、過(guò)零寬度統(tǒng)計(jì) 模塊、周期統(tǒng)計(jì)模塊和時(shí)間校正模塊;所述輸入信號(hào)和濾波信號(hào)經(jīng)濾波模塊后,輸出濾波后 信號(hào)、信號(hào)1和信號(hào)2,所述信號(hào)1為濾波模塊中異或門的輸出信號(hào),所述信號(hào)2為濾波模塊 中比較器1的輸出信號(hào);濾波后信號(hào)經(jīng)周期統(tǒng)計(jì)模塊后輸出周期信號(hào),周期為T;信號(hào)1和 信號(hào)2經(jīng)過(guò)零寬度統(tǒng)計(jì)模塊后輸出過(guò)零寬度信號(hào),過(guò)零寬度為Tz;濾波后信號(hào)、周期信號(hào)、 過(guò)零寬度信號(hào)及濾波信號(hào)經(jīng)時(shí)間校正模塊后,輸出修正后的信號(hào)。
7. 根據(jù)權(quán)利要求6所述的一種矩形波信號(hào)過(guò)零濾波裝置,其特征在于:所述濾波模塊 包括異或門、跳變計(jì)數(shù)器1、比較器1、D觸發(fā)器1 ;所述濾波模塊用于濾除輸入信號(hào)上升、下 降沿、高低電平時(shí)的干擾;所述輸入信號(hào)分別于與異或門的一個(gè)輸入端和D觸發(fā)器1的輸入 端連接;異或門的輸出端與跳變計(jì)數(shù)器1的清零端連接,異或門的輸出端輸出信號(hào)1 ;時(shí)鐘 信號(hào)CLK與跳變計(jì)數(shù)器1的CLK端連接,跳變計(jì)數(shù)器1的輸出端與比較器1的A輸入端連 接;濾波時(shí)間1與比較器1的B輸入端連接,比較器1的輸出端與D觸發(fā)器1的時(shí)鐘輸入 端連接,比較器1的輸出端輸出信號(hào)2 ;觸發(fā)器1的輸出端與異或門的另一個(gè)輸入端連接, 觸發(fā)器1輸出濾波后的信號(hào)。
8. 根據(jù)權(quán)利要求6所述的一種矩形波信號(hào)過(guò)零濾波裝置,其特征在于:所述過(guò)零寬度 統(tǒng)計(jì)模塊包括復(fù)位優(yōu)先RS觸發(fā)器、計(jì)數(shù)器2、D觸發(fā)器2、與門1及4個(gè)反相器;所述過(guò)零寬 度統(tǒng)計(jì)模塊用于統(tǒng)計(jì)出輸入信號(hào)過(guò)零點(diǎn)干擾寬度;所述信號(hào)1分別連接RS觸發(fā)器的S端和 與門1的一個(gè)輸入端,所述信號(hào)2分別連接RS觸發(fā)器的R端與門1的另一輸入端,RS觸發(fā) 器的輸出端與計(jì)數(shù)器2的使能端連接,時(shí)鐘信號(hào)CLK與計(jì)數(shù)器2的CLK端連接,信息2經(jīng)反 相器后與計(jì)數(shù)器2的清零端連接,計(jì)數(shù)器2的輸出端與D觸發(fā)器2的輸入端連接,與門1的 輸出端與D觸發(fā)器2的CLK端連接,D觸發(fā)器2輸出過(guò)零寬度信號(hào),過(guò)零寬度為Tz。
9. 根據(jù)權(quán)利要求6所述的一種矩形波信號(hào)過(guò)零濾波裝置,其特征在于:所訴周期統(tǒng)計(jì) 模塊包括D觸發(fā)器3、D觸發(fā)器4、計(jì)數(shù)器3、與門2及兩個(gè)反相器;所述周期統(tǒng)計(jì)模塊以濾波 模塊的輸出作為本模塊的輸入信號(hào),統(tǒng)計(jì)其周期數(shù)據(jù);所述濾波后信號(hào)分別連接D觸發(fā)器3 的輸入端和與門2的一個(gè)輸入端,時(shí)鐘信號(hào)CLK分別與D觸發(fā)器3的CLK端和計(jì)數(shù)器3的 CLK端連接,D觸發(fā)器3的輸出端連接與門2的另一輸出入端,與門2的輸出端經(jīng)反相器與 計(jì)數(shù)器3的清零端連接,計(jì)數(shù)器3的輸出端與D觸發(fā)器4的輸入端連接,與門2的輸出端與 D觸發(fā)器4的CLK端連接,D觸發(fā)器4的輸出端輸出周期信號(hào),周期為T。
10. 根據(jù)權(quán)利要求6所述的一種矩形波信號(hào)過(guò)零濾波裝置,其特征在于:所述時(shí)間校正 模塊包括加法器、D觸發(fā)器5、計(jì)數(shù)器4、比較器4、比較器5、與門3 ;所示時(shí)間校正模塊用于 對(duì)信號(hào)的濾波延遲進(jìn)行補(bǔ)償,輸出修正后的信號(hào);所述濾波時(shí)間信號(hào)連接加法器的A輸入 端,過(guò)零寬度信號(hào)連接加法器的B輸入端,加法器的輸出端與計(jì)數(shù)器4的輸入端連接,濾波 后信號(hào)分別連接D觸發(fā)器5輸入端和與門3的一個(gè)輸入端,D觸發(fā)器5的輸出端連接與門3 的另一個(gè)輸入端;時(shí)鐘信號(hào)CLK分別連接D觸發(fā)器5的CLK端和計(jì)數(shù)器4的CLK端,與門3 的輸出端連接計(jì)數(shù)器4的PE端,計(jì)數(shù)器4的輸出端分別連接比較器2的A輸入端和比較器 3的A輸入端,周期信號(hào)分別連接比較器2的B輸入端和比較器3的輸入端,比較器3的輸 出端與計(jì)數(shù)器4的清零端連接,比較器2輸出最后經(jīng)修正的信號(hào)。
【專利摘要】本發(fā)明涉及一種矩形波信號(hào)過(guò)零濾波方法及裝置,屬于電子技術(shù)領(lǐng)域。該方法具體步驟如下:輸入信號(hào)經(jīng)濾波模塊進(jìn)行濾波處理,輸出具有Tf延遲的濾波后信號(hào);通過(guò)過(guò)零寬度統(tǒng)計(jì)模塊統(tǒng)計(jì)信號(hào)的過(guò)零寬度Tz;通過(guò)周期統(tǒng)計(jì)模塊統(tǒng)計(jì)濾波后信號(hào)的周期T;根據(jù)信號(hào)的周期、過(guò)零點(diǎn)干擾寬度、過(guò)零點(diǎn)時(shí)刻,經(jīng)時(shí)間校正模塊對(duì)信號(hào)的濾波延遲進(jìn)行補(bǔ)償,輸出修正后的信號(hào)。本發(fā)明提供的一種矩形波信號(hào)過(guò)零濾波方法及裝置,根據(jù)干擾的時(shí)刻和寬度來(lái)確定過(guò)零信號(hào)的正確發(fā)生時(shí)間,對(duì)信號(hào)的濾波延遲進(jìn)行補(bǔ)償,輸出信號(hào)下一個(gè)跳變的正確時(shí)刻,具有較好的濾波效果。
【IPC分類】H03K5-13
【公開(kāi)號(hào)】CN104811166
【申請(qǐng)?zhí)枴緾N201510256299
【發(fā)明人】程森林, 趙曉兀, 王燕, 何強(qiáng)志
【申請(qǐng)人】重慶大學(xué)
【公開(kāi)日】2015年7月29日
【申請(qǐng)日】2015年5月19日